WebOct 29, 2024 · The RCM’s ‘Midwives Midwife of the Year’ award recognises a midwife from each UK country. England - Tania Pearce, East Surrey Hospital. Scotland - Frances Arrowsmith, NHS Highland. Wales - Sarah Hookes, NHS Wales Shared Services Partnership. Northern Ireland - Susanne Thomas, Belfast Health and Social Care Trust. HEE is also supporting neonatal services with the implementation of the … WebSep 21, 2024 · Every year the NHS in England pays compensation claims when care goes wrong. Last year, there were 10,284 negligence claims. Of those, 12% - 1,243 - were for maternity.
